Navigating the Risks: BMS Digital Safety Best Practices

Protecting your Building Management System (BMS) from online threats is absolutely important for facility performance . Enacting robust digital safety measures is not an option, but a requirement . Here's key best approaches to lessen risk:

  • Frequently perform security assessments to discover weaknesses .
  • Mandate strong, complex passwords and layered authentication for all operator logins.
  • Isolate your BMS infrastructure from other business networks to restrict potential impact .
  • Update all BMS firmware and hardware to the newest versions to patch known protection deficiencies.
  • Deliver thorough security education to all employees who manage the BMS.

Following these tactics will significantly improve your BMS digital protection framework and safeguard your vital building assets .

Cybersecurity for Building Management Systems: A Critical Overview

Building automation platforms, vital for contemporary infrastructure, are increasingly susceptible to cyberattacks. These integrated systems, which control everything from heating and illumination to safety and ventilation, present a significant challenge for facility operators. Historically, many control systems were designed without adequate protection, making them attractive targets for malicious actors. The potential effects of a successful intrusion can be devastating, including failure of critical functions, financial losses, and harm to image. get more info A proactive and multi-faceted plan is therefore necessary, encompassing periodic vulnerability assessments, strong identification protocols, and ongoing monitoring of system activity.

  • Assess potential risks.
  • Implement strong credentials.
  • Maintain software and firmware regularly.
  • Educate personnel on cybersecurity best practices.
